Re: Tecnacraft "Nice Set of Wheels" Ad
You guys are out of control. Great collections. Makes mine look small. I am going to dig through some old paperwork and see if I can find out exactly how many wheel sets we made. They quit selling in the early 90's and I did not make any more. I only took some samples to the Chicago show for folks to look at. I guess the $99.price tag was a bit high. That would be a steal today.
I am looking into remaking some it will be a 1 time limited run and they will be marked as vintage so there is no confusion. I do not want to ruin the value of the original ones.
Thanks for all the pictures and comments.
Joe

Re: Tecnacraft "Nice Set of Wheels" Ad
I all depends on cost for all of us. If I can get them made for a reasonable price has a lot to do with them getting made. Most shops want you to run hundreds of parts to get the cost down. I am trying to explain to these guys that numbers will be on a smaller scale but I want the highest quality. Material also plays a big part of the process. We always used only Aircraft grade aluminum. The centers are cut from billet stock. I did not remember it being this much trouble all those years ago. lol Just got to get all the ducks in a straight line.
I am going to give this a lot of effort to make it happen.
Joe
